Skip to content

Commit b82b626

Browse files
aepflitoddbaert
andauthored
Update providers/openfeature-provider-flagd/src/openfeature/contrib/provider/flagd/resolvers/grpc.py
Co-authored-by: Todd Baert <[email protected]> Signed-off-by: Simon Schrottner <[email protected]>
1 parent 830a6de commit b82b626

File tree

1 file changed

+1
-0
lines changed
  • providers/openfeature-provider-flagd/src/openfeature/contrib/provider/flagd/resolvers

1 file changed

+1
-0
lines changed

providers/openfeature-provider-flagd/src/openfeature/contrib/provider/flagd/resolvers/grpc.py

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-127,6 +127,7 @@ def listen(self) -> None:
127127
return
128128
except grpc.RpcError as e:
129129
logger.error(f"SyncFlags stream error, {e.code()=} {e.details()=}")
130+
# re-create the stub if there's a connection issue - otherwise reconnect does not work as expected
130131
self.stub, self.channel = self._create_stub()
131132
except ParseError:
132133
logger.exception(

0 commit comments

Comments
 (0)